In-Depth Analysis

The safety of elderly residents in Rural Mid Devon is a priority, reflected in the area’s positive safety indicators. The crime rate in Rural Mid Devon stands at 31.6 incidents per 1,000 residents, significantly lower than the UK average of 91.6 per 1,000. This suggests a comparatively safe environment for all residents, including the elderly. Furthermore, Rural Mid Devon boasts a safety score of 92 out of 100, exceeding the UK average of 79, indicating a high level of perceived safety within the community.

The violent crime rate is also comparatively low at 15.8 per 1,000 residents. While specific measures directly targeting elderly residents are not explicitly detailed in the available data, the overall low crime rate and high safety score point to a supportive and secure environment. This suggests that general crime prevention strategies employed within Mid Devon benefit all age groups.
